About 28 Auctioneers Close

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

28 Auctioneers Close is a semi-detached house in Plymouth (PL7 1AH). It has a recorded floor area of 54 m² (around 581 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2007-2011 and council tax band B. At 54 m² this is the 3rd smallest of 40 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 2–116 m². The building's EPC ratings span C to B, with this unit at the bottom. The latest certificate (November 2021) shows a C (score 80), near the top of the C band. Earlier certificates rated it B (January 2011);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, wall ef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and roof ef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good.

Today's modelled estimate of £130,000 sits 122.2% above the 2022 sale of £58,500.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£101/sq ft) was about 54.2% below the postcode norm. At 54 m² it sits well below the postcode median (80 m² across 39 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 72% of similar EPCs). Most recent transfer: April 2022 at £58,500.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
